Babu, a humble tea vendor, falls deeply in love with Uma, a wealthy young woman who returns his affection because of his sincerity. When a doctor proposes, Uma accepts the match for a secure future, prompting an anguished Babu to sue her for cheating.

In Chennai, Dhanush plays Babu, a steady, warm-hearted tea vendor who keeps his small business alive by pedaling a bicycle through the city and serving milk tea with a smile. He leads a simple life, but his days take a hopeful turn when he falls for Uma, a wealthy college student whose world looks very different from his own. The romance between Babu and Sridevi Vijayakumar–portrayed Uma–unfolds with a quiet chemistry, built on mutual respect and a shared sense of decency. Babu’s good nature draws Uma in, and for a time, life seems to align with the dream of two people from opposite ends of society finding common ground.

Uma’s parents envision a different future for their daughter: they arrange for Bala, a affluent, well-educated suitor, to become her husband. Bala’s comforts represent a life of ease and opportunity that contrasts starkly with Babu’s frugal, laboring existence. Uma faces a painful internal conflict. The film lays out a stark mental contrast for her: if she stays with Babu, she fears a life where money is scarce and medical expenses loom large; if she marries Bala, she imagines a life where every want is catered to, and status smooths every path. The narrative keeps her dilemma nuanced, showing both the emotional pull of true affection and the security of a privileged future.

While Babu travels on a religious trip to Sabarimala, Uma’s resolve hardens toward Bala, and she ultimately agrees to marry him to preserve a life of comfort and stability. When Babu learns of this decision, his world shakes. He is heartbroken not only by love lost, but by what he perceives as a betrayal of their shared hopes. The relationship strains under the strain of social class, and Babu’s sense of being dismissed by Uma and her family deepens the ache he feels inside.

The story takes a sudden, painful turn after a Valentine’s Day gathering when Babu, overwhelmed by despair, attempts to take his own life. He is arrested and brought to the police station, where an inspector subjects him to harsh treatment. The moment is pivotal: Babu’s friend, the orphaned Kaduppu Subramani [Karunas], speaks up for him, pleading with the authorities that there is no one to look after them if something happens to either of them. This plea shifts the inspector’s approach and leads to a more humane consideration of Babu’s circumstances, setting the stage for a courtroom confrontation that reaches far beyond a single love story.

In a bold, unconventional move, Babu files a case against Uma, not merely to win her back, but to press the point that a promise to share a life together for fifty years should be treated with seriousness and accountability. The case quickly becomes a topic of public conversation, drawing attention to the sacrifices Babu has quietly made and the social dynamics that shaped Uma’s decision. Throughout the proceedings, more is revealed about the depths of Babu’s loyalty and the extent of his willingness to endure hardship for the sake of their possible future together.

As witnesses come forward and memories are revisited, the public learns of the quiet compromises Babu has made for Uma’s sake. The narrative paints a picture of a man who has given up comforts, who has faced social judgment, and who has endured personal pain with dignity. Uma, confronted with the consequences of her choices, undergoes a transformation as she witnesses the extent of Babu’s devotion and the costs his love has incurred. The courtroom becomes a space where truth, sacrifice, and the social pressures of class and education are laid bare, and Uma’s stance begins to shift.

By the final day of the hearing, Uma experiences a change of heart and contemplates reuniting with Babu. The moment arrives when she approaches him with a rose, symbolizing reconciliation. Yet Babu holds steady in his resolve. He refuses to accept her gesture as a trivial concession. He explains that his case was never about winning her back for himself but about preventing others from suffering similar heartbreak and injustice. He speaks plainly, acknowledging the realities of their different worlds: yesterday she may have despised him for his lack of status, today she may feel affection, yet tomorrow she could again drift away. He also reveals a personal vulnerability—his limited command of English—which he feels contributed to their misunderstandings and her decision to leave him. As they part at the courthouse, his final word to her is simple and poignant: “Goodbye.”

The film, told through a careful balance of romance, social critique, and courtroom drama, emphasizes the dignity of a man who chooses integrity over possession and the courage it takes to challenge a social system that advantages some and underestimates others. The cast brings to life a cast of supporting figures who illuminate the stakes of the central conflict, from friends who stand by Babu to family members who embody contrasting expectations of success and security. The resolution arrives not in a sweeping declaration of triumph, but in a quiet, mature understanding that love can endure in the right form, and that justice sometimes means protecting people from future pain, even when it costs something deeply personal.
